This is 'crumple' origami. Used a lot by French origamists 'Le CRIMP'.
Thin, crisp paper (here tracing paper) is folded and then crushed. The process allows the paper to be shaped into flexible, organic forms.
This paper was coated in cyanotype. The form I made was exposed in the sun for 10 minutes, and developed.
If I hadn't put my fingers through the wet paper it would be good!

Sometimes things fail.
I've been trying to get back into origami practice with John Montroll's - 'A Constellation of Origami Polyhedra' (https://johnmontroll.com/books/a-constellation-of-origami-polyhedra/).
Using 75 cm squares of tracing paper made it harder - wrong paper for these models.
The crease patterns are beautiful - this is for a Sunken Cuboctohedron. But I've failed to fully fold them into 3D shape.
But it's OK. Sometimes things fail.
